Plugs, sockets & voltage in Thailand
Plug type
In Thailand, sockets take Type A / Type B / Type C / Type O plugs. The supply is 220V at 50Hz.

What each socket looks like
| Type A | Two flat parallel pins (ungrounded). Common across North America and Japan. |
|---|---|
| Type B | Two flat pins plus a round grounding pin. The grounded North American plug. |
| Type C | Two round pins. The standard "Europlug" used across most of Europe. |
| Type O | Three round pins. Used in Thailand. |
Thailand runs on 220V. Visitors from 100–120 V countries should confirm their devices are dual-voltage, or pack a converter for single-voltage gear.
